AI Technical Summary
Existing open-vocabulary semantic segmentation methods suffer from problems such as instance-level semantic instability, strong cross-instance interference, and inconsistent local view reasoning in complex scenarios, making it difficult to effectively solve the problems of semantic breakage and boundary fragmentation within instances.
By using an instance-based semantic prototype-guided approach, an instance mask is generated. The instance mask and auxiliary visual features are used to constrain the scope and strength of visual word associations. An instance semantic prototype is then constructed for guided correction and progressive propagation refinement, achieving cross-view consistency fusion.
It improves regional consistency and boundary quality, enhances the semantic discrimination ability of open lexical terms, reduces the risk of error propagation, and improves the stability and accuracy of segmentation results.
